OpenSim
|
Public Member Functions | |
abstract AssetBase | GetAsset (UUID uuid) |
abstract bool | StoreAsset (AssetBase asset) |
abstract bool[] | AssetsExist (UUID[] uuids) |
abstract List< AssetMetadata > | FetchAssetMetadataSet (int start, int count) |
abstract void | Initialise (string connect) |
abstract void | Initialise () |
Default-initialises the plugin More... | |
abstract void | Dispose () |
abstract bool | Delete (string id) |
Properties | |
abstract string | Version [get] |
abstract string | Name [get] |
Properties inherited from OpenSim.Framework.IPlugin | |
string | Version [get] |
Returns the plugin version More... | |
string | Name [get] |
Returns the plugin name More... | |
Definition at line 37 of file AssetDataBase.cs.
|
pure virtual |
Implements OpenSim.Data.IAssetDataPlugin.
Implemented in OpenSim.Data.MySQL.MySQLAssetData, OpenSim.Data.PGSQL.PGSQLAssetData, and OpenSim.Data.SQLite.SQLiteAssetData.
|
pure virtual |
Implements OpenSim.Data.IAssetDataPlugin.
Implemented in OpenSim.Data.SQLite.SQLiteAssetData, OpenSim.Data.MySQL.MySQLAssetData, and OpenSim.Data.PGSQL.PGSQLAssetData.
|
pure virtual |
|
pure virtual |
Implements OpenSim.Data.IAssetDataPlugin.
Implemented in OpenSim.Data.SQLite.SQLiteAssetData, OpenSim.Data.MySQL.MySQLAssetData, and OpenSim.Data.PGSQL.PGSQLAssetData.
|
pure virtual |
Implements OpenSim.Data.IAssetDataPlugin.
Implemented in OpenSim.Data.PGSQL.PGSQLAssetData, OpenSim.Data.MySQL.MySQLAssetData, and OpenSim.Data.SQLite.SQLiteAssetData.
|
pure virtual |
Implements OpenSim.Data.IAssetDataPlugin.
Implemented in OpenSim.Data.SQLite.SQLiteAssetData, OpenSim.Data.PGSQL.PGSQLAssetData, and OpenSim.Data.MySQL.MySQLAssetData.
|
pure virtual |
Default-initialises the plugin
Implements OpenSim.Framework.IPlugin.
Implemented in OpenSim.Data.SQLite.SQLiteAssetData, OpenSim.Data.MySQL.MySQLAssetData, and OpenSim.Data.PGSQL.PGSQLAssetData.
|
pure virtual |
Implements OpenSim.Data.IAssetDataPlugin.
Implemented in OpenSim.Data.MySQL.MySQLAssetData, OpenSim.Data.PGSQL.PGSQLAssetData, and OpenSim.Data.SQLite.SQLiteAssetData.
|
get |
Definition at line 46 of file AssetDataBase.cs.
|
get |
Definition at line 45 of file AssetDataBase.cs.